Troubleshooting
|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
| Engine won't start | Fuel issue | Check fuel level and quality; ensure choke is set correctly. |
| Auger not turning | Drive belt issue | Inspect drive belt for damage; replace if necessary. |
| Snow not being discharged | Clogged chute | Clear any obstructions from the chute. |
| Excessive vibration | Loose components | Tighten all bolts and screws; check for damaged parts. |
Specifications
- Engine Type: Gasoline, 4-cycle.
- Clearing Width: 32 inches.
- Weight: Approximately 200 lbs.
- Fuel Capacity: 3.5 quarts.
- Auger Type: Steel, serrated.
